Fidelity and Vanguard Halt Grants to SPLC Amidst Legal Concerns

The Southern Poverty Law Center (SPLC), a nationally recognized civil rights nonprofit, is currently embroiled in legal controversy after being indicted by the Justice Department on charges of financial misconduct, including wire fraud and money laundering. As a result, Fidelity (NASDAQ:FDBC) Charitable and Vanguard Charitable, prominent philanthropic entities that manage donor-advised funds, have announced a temporary suspension of grants to the SPLC. These developments highlight the intersection of philanthropy and legal accountability, raising questions about the implications for donor-advised funds in similar scenarios.

Fidelity and Vanguard’s move comes after long-held standards in the philanthropic world, where any allegations or charges against a potential grant recipient can influence grant-making decisions. This set of standards aims to ensure the integrity of charitable endeavors but also poses complexities when organizations like SPLC face serious accusations. In recent years, the SPLC has faced various legal challenges, yet still managed to maintain its position as a key player in civil rights advocacy. These past incidents illustrate how ongoing investigations can significantly impact an organization’s operations and public perception.

Why Have Grants Been Paused?

Fidelity Charitable has expressed a clear stance on its decision, stating that any ongoing governmental investigations disqualify an organization as an eligible grant recipient. This approach is consistent with Fidelity’s existing grant-making standards and practices.

“Consistent with our grant-making standards and practices, the organization is not an eligible grant recipient during the ongoing investigation,” Fidelity Charitable mentioned in correspondence to a donor.

How Is Vanguard Charitable Responding?

Vanguard Charitable shared similar reasoning for the decision to pause their support for the SPLC. The organization stressed that charges that could question an organization’s ability to fulfill its charitable purpose were taken into account.

“All grant decisions are made based on the information available at the time of the grant recommendation,” a spokesperson for Vanguard Charitable confirmed.

Fidelity and Vanguard operate donor-advised funds, which allow individuals to contribute tax-deductible donations and recommend how the funds are allocated over time. Both organizations are adhering to IRS eligibility requirements and are prepared to continue their pause should additional information emerge during the investigation.

The Justice Department’s indictment against SPLC involves allegations that the organization misappropriated $3 million in donations, allegedly channeling them to individuals associated with extremist groups. In past scenarios, similar allegations have posed significant reputational risks to nonprofits but have also spurred discussions on improving transparency and governance in the non-profit sector.

The situation shines a light on the delicate balance between charitable missions and accountability. For philanthropic bodies, the incident demonstrates the importance of adhering to regulatory frameworks and committing to ethical practices. Observers are keenly following the development, understanding that this case might set precedents for how charities navigate legal challenges moving forward.
